Key Facts

  • Syvalion's instance of is recorded as video game[3].
  • Syvalion's composer is recorded as Hayato Matsuo[4].
  • Syvalion's publisher is recorded as Taito[5].
  • Syvalion's genre is recorded as shoot 'em up[6].
  • Syvalion's developer is recorded as Taito[7].
  • Syvalion's platform is recorded as arcade video game machine[8].
  • Syvalion's platform is recorded as Super Nintendo Entertainment System[9].
  • Syvalion's input device is recorded as trackball[10].
  • Syvalion's country of origin is recorded as Japan[11].
  • Syvalion's publication date is recorded as +1988-01-01T00:00:00Z[12].
